<B>A Rare Complete Set -- Louis Prang's "Magic Cards".</B></I> A wonderful and complete set of twelve "Magic Cards" printed by Louis Prang of Boston, 1865. Each card measures 2.5" x 4.5", and bears a double image -- the second revealed when the viewer rotates the card 180 degrees. Accompanied by the original tri-fold instruction card giving commentary on each image. Examples include "The Chivalrous Rebel" which, when turned upside down reveals a horse eating from a bag of oats. A wonderful example of the early work of Louis Prang who became well-known later in the century for his chromolithography. Overall the set is quite clean with the occasional foxed spot, brochure bears partial separation at folds, else very fine condition. We have seen individual cards in the market -- this is the FIRST time we have seen the complete set offered together with the original descriptive booklet.
